How much does it cost to rent a home in North Lawrence?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| North Lawrence 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,074 | $825 | $1,350 |
| North Lawrence 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,650 | $1,050 | $2,500 |
| North Lawrence 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,531 | $1,700 | $3,375 |

Frequently Asked Questions about North Lawrence
What type of rentals are currently available in North Lawrence?
There are currently 43 Apartments for Rent in North Lawrence, OH with pricing that ranges from $545 to $2,515. There are also 32 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in North Lawrence ranging from $625 to $3,375.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in North Lawrence?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in North Lawrence ranges from $625 to $3,375 with an average monthly rent of $1,330.
